K798 GRC MOT History
Interpretation generated from the recorded test data above — not an official DVSA statement and not a substitute for an independent inspection.
4 MOT tests are recorded for this 1992 Volkswagen Motor Caravan (K798 GRC) between March 2022 and June 2026.
The record contains 2 passes and 2 failures.
The most recent test on 30 June 2026 was a fail; the vehicle has not passed its last recorded MOT.
Across all tests, the most frequently flagged areas are: Tyres (2 issues), Bodywork (2 issues), Windscreen (2 issues), Lighting (1 issue), Brakes (1 issue). Repeated mentions in one area can indicate an ongoing pattern worth checking in person.
In total 4 advisory notices are recorded. Advisories flag items that passed but may need attention before the next test; they are not evidence of how well the vehicle has been serviced.
Recorded failure items include: “Power steering inoperative and steering adversely affected (2.1.5 (c) (ii))”; “Rear Brakes imbalanced across an axle Axle 2 (1.2.1 (b) (i))”; “Rear fog lamp not working (4.5.1 (a) (ii))”.
